I have been a tom tom navigator 5 owner for around three months. Last week I activated the free one month trial on Traffic. I was not expecting too much after reading some of the comments, but I have to say that I love the product, (so far).
In just one week it has helped me avoid 5 potential jams. I drive around 40, 000 miles a week and do a lot around the main motorways in the South East, so I may be lucky in getting good support for the roads, but I honestly feel for less than a pound a week, it is a "no brainer".

Glad someone's happy....

Last time I used it - TT said the roads were clear so I ignored the overhead gantry signs on the M25 and followed TT5 to go north up the M1. At which point I ended up in a traffic jam due to an accident for 45 mins. All the while a green blob, plenty of updates......nothing. Road supposed to be free. There is a lesson to be learnt there....!
